Philadelphia, known for its rich history, vibrant culture, and diverse neighborhoods, offers a unique living experience. From the bustling streets of Center City to the serene parks of Fairmount, each area presents its own charm and character. The city is not only a hub for history enthusiasts and foodies but also provides ample opportunities for employment, education, and recreation, making it an ideal place for both individuals and families looking to settle down.
When it comes to buying property in Philadelphia, timing and knowledge are key. Understanding the local market trends, property values, and future development plans can significantly impact your investment. It's essential to work with a real estate professional who knows the ins and outs of the Philadelphia market. They can guide you through the process, from finding the right neighborhood to negotiating the best price for your dream home.
Selling your property in Philadelphia requires a strategic approach. With the right marketing techniques and presentation, you can attract potential buyers looking for a piece of this vibrant city. Staging your home, setting a competitive price, and utilizing digital marketing platforms can enhance your property's visibility and appeal, ensuring a swift and profitable sale.
For those not ready to buy, renting in Philadelphia offers flexibility and a chance to explore different neighborhoods. The city boasts a wide range of rental options, from luxury apartments to affordable homes. Understanding your rights as a tenant and familiarizing yourself with the lease terms can help you find a rental that meets your needs and budget.
Philadelphia's property market continues to thrive, offering numerous opportunities for buyers, sellers, and renters. By staying informed and working with the right professionals, you can navigate the real estate landscape with confidence and find your place in this dynamic city.
